Tax practitioners must adhere to prescribed standards of ethics and quality.
Join us for this annual tax ethics course, where Edward R. Jenkins, CPA, CGMA, and Sarah McGregor, CPA, of the AICPA’s Tax Practice Responsibilities Committee will:
- Review why ethics is essential in tax practice
- Delve into existing rules and standards from Circular No. 230
- Review the AICPA Statements on Standards for Tax Services (SSTSs)
They will illustrate real-life examples of ethical situations to help you navigate challenging circumstances.
Key Topics
- Annual tax ethics update
- Circular 230
- AICPA Statements on Standards for Tax Services (SSTSs)
Learning Outcomes
- Recall the ethical requirements that CPA tax practitioners must adhere to, including Circular 230, the AICPA Code of Professional Conduct and SSTSs.
- Identify which rule or standard has the highest authority.
- Apply real-life ethical dilemma examples to your tax practice.
